Correspondences between Jet Spaces and PDE Systems
Journal of Lie Theory, Volume 15 (2005) no. 1, pp. 197-218
Following some of Lie's ideas, we define between jet spaces canonical correspondences which allow us to associate with each first order PDE system another one with a single unknown function which contains as solutions that of the original system as well as its intermediate integrals. We also show for some systems of PDE that their integration is equivalent to that of their associated ones.
